Biography

Before joining LIONS, I was a postdoctoral researcher at the ELLIS Institute Tübingen. I completed my PhD in the ELLIS programme at the University of Freiburg, supervised by Frank Hutter and co-supervised by Yee Whye Teh at the University of Oxford. Since 2025, I am also an ELLIS Member. My research focuses on designing efficient and adaptive intelligent systems, including sub-quadratic sequence models, multi-objective optimization algorithms, and emergent computation.
